Stock Photo - Tabernacle door with coat of arms of the Piccolomini, Tabernacle door of walnut. Two Corinthian half-columns on a cloaked base flank a niche and support the main frame. The frieze and the base are decorated with leaf and flower motifs. Hanging bell clocks are placed on either side of the half-columns. The attachment shows a Christ's head in the middle within an onion-shaped medallion, surrounded by aisles and flanked by a bird, vase with flame and a cherub head. At the bottom a cherub above a coat of arms with the coat of arms of the Piccolomini., anonymous, Siena, 1485 - 1500, wood (plant material), walnut (hardwood), gilding (material), gilding, h 34 cm × w 17 cm × d 3.5 cm
